First off, what exactly are stainless steel mud valves? These are specialized valves designed for controlling the flow of fluids with a high content of solids—think drilling mud in the oil and gas sector. Their design allows them to handle extreme conditions, such as high pressure and abrasive materials.
But why stainless steel? This material offers corrosion resistance and durability, making it a top choice for any application that demands high performance and safety.

Now, let’s explore some real-world examples. Take, for instance, the process of drilling for oil. The drilling mud used in these operations is a complex mixture designed to cool the drill bit and carry rock cuttings to the surface. Stainless steel mud valves play an indispensable role in regulating this flow. Their efficiency ensures that the drilling process remains smooth and uninterrupted, reducing downtime and maximizing productivity.
Another example can be seen in wastewater treatment facilities. These plants need reliable valves to manage fluids containing solids. Here, stainless steel mud valves excel not only in performance but also in maintenance. Their durable construction means less frequent replacements, which can save facilities both time and money.
